California Real Estate Practice - 1st Edition
Bob Herd 527 pages, Cengage 2006
…………
In his newest book, California Real Estate Practice, Bob Herd explains the body of law and ethics vital to the daily practice of real estate. He discusses fair housing, full-disclosure and laws governing real estate licensees, and teaches agents how to perform important real estate procedures. Herd has packed the book with the most effective methods for utilizing current technology and working with an increasingly “techno-savvy” public.

California Mortgage Loan Brokering Lending - 3rd Edition
D.L. Grogan M. C. Buzz Chambers
709 pages, Cengage 2006
…………
Two of the finest and most trusted California real estate authors, Prof Grogan and M.C. “Buzz” Chambers, once again deliver the definitive textbook for individuals seeking to enter the mortgage loan business. The new third edition of California Mortgage Loan Brokering & Lending provides comprehensive coverage of finance laws through 2006 and covers the key topics of appraisal, credit agencies, title and escrow, and industry technology. The third edition also extensively covers the variety of the forms necessary to complete a transaction. This is an approved course textbook for pre-licensing in California.

California Real Estate Finance - 8th Edition
Robert J Bond Dennis J McKenzie
Alfred Gavello
512 pages, Cengage 2006
…………
Highly practical in focus, this new edition of California Real Estate Finance continues to be one of the most applicable and pertinent texts available today. The completely revised 8th Edition includes expanded coverage of institutional and non-institutional lenders, negative amortized loans, sub-prime loans, predatory lending, customary buyer and seller closing costs, a glossary and financial calculator, and much more.
